Output 2d5a1a77d5d8fb52d86d8fed043aa09452f37054252260b7c79a52ed3f828b1b:25

value
431494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 708271a161337752b5b4981d84209e2a8f24c364 OP_EQUAL
address
3BwusRksT1xrY2PBsfvhSeFcHdWCTgE2Gf
transaction
2d5a1a77d5d8fb52d86d8fed043aa09452f37054252260b7c79a52ed3f828b1b
spent
true